Margaret Allen, Map 48 Parcel 40, is accessed by Willow Creek Road as it has no frontage on East Street. (See minutes of April 3, 2008) The access to Post Farm from Willow Creek continues to be blocked by logs and pallets. This issue was discussed with Town Counsel approximately five months ago. Town Counsel determined that the town has legal right to access Post Farm via this point and Town Counsel advised the Town Planner that he would notify the abutters of this fact and send a copy of that letter to the Conservation Commission for their records. As of this date, this has not been done. The Commission has asked PA to notify Town Counsel and asked that he follow through with notification. PA will send notification to Town Counsel via the Town Planner, Mary Albertson.
